1. Diversity of Java development tasks

Java development tasks cover many areas, from enterprise applications to mobile development, from Web applications to big data processing. Enterprise application development usually requires building stable and efficient systems to support the business operations of enterprises. For example, the core transaction system of banks and the backend management system of e-commerce platforms are inseparable from the powerful functions of Java. In terms of mobile development, although Android native development mainly uses Java or Kotlin, the foundation of Java is essential for understanding and mastering the principles and techniques of mobile development. Web application development has always been a strong point of Java, and frameworks such as Spring Boot and Spring MVC provide developers with efficient development tools. In the field of big data processing, technical frameworks such as Hadoop also rely on Java to implement data processing and analysis.

2. Impact of Industry Trends on Java Development

The development of the industry constantly affects Java development tasks. With the rise of cloud computing, Java developers need to master cloud-native technologies to better deploy applications in the cloud. Containerization technologies such as Docker and Kubernetes have changed the way applications are deployed and maintained, and Java applications also need to be optimized and adapted accordingly. The development of artificial intelligence and machine learning has also brought new opportunities and challenges to Java development. Although Python dominates the fields of data science and machine learning, Java can be used to build backend services to support machine learning models. At the same time, Java developers also need to understand the basic concepts and algorithms of machine learning in order to better collaborate with data scientists and algorithm engineers.

3. Skill improvement and career development for Java developers

In the face of ever-changing industry demands, Java developers need to continuously improve their skills. In addition to mastering the characteristics of the Java language itself and related frameworks, they also need to understand other related technologies and tools. For example, they need to be familiar with database operations, master front-end development knowledge, and have a good foundation in algorithms and data structures. In terms of career development, Java developers can choose different directions based on their interests and expertise. The technical expert route requires in-depth research and practical experience in specific fields and the ability to solve complex technical problems. The project management route requires good teamwork and communication skills to effectively promote project progress.
